Why Supply Chain Visibility Alone Won’t Be Enough in 2026

by Guest on Mar 3, 2026 Management 103 Views

In 2026, supply chains are more digital, interconnected, and data-driven than ever before. Companies across industries have invested heavily in dashboards, real-time tracking systems, IoT-enabled devices, and control towers to provide end-to-end visibility of supply chains. At first glance, it seems like visibility addresses the biggest problem of knowing where products, inventory, and shipments are at any given time.

However, visibility is no longer sufficient. In a world shaped by geopolitical uncertainty, climate disruptions, regulatory shifts, cyber threats, and shifting customer expectations, companies require more than visibility. They require intelligence, agility, resilience, and predictive capabilities. 

The Rise of Visibility in Modern Supply Chains

Supply chain visibility has evolved from a competitive advantage into a baseline expectation. Organizations today are able to track shipments in real-time, manage warehouse operations through automated software, and view supplier information on a single platform. IoT sensors, cloud infrastructure, blockchain, and AI-powered analytics have enabled organizations to build a real-time picture of global operations.

Using these technologies, organizations are able to identify delays, track inventory, and react to disruptions in a timely manner. Visibility has reduced blind spots and enabled better collaboration between suppliers, manufacturers, distributors, and retailers. Visibility has enhanced accountability and customer communication.

However, even with complete visibility, organizations are still facing disruptions, delays, and losses. Why? Because knowing what is happening does not necessarily mean knowing what to do next.

From Visibility to Predictive Intelligence

In 2026, disruptions in the supply chain are no longer exceptions; they have become the norm. Disruptions can come in the form of natural disasters, trade policies, transportation constraints, and cyberattacks at any moment. Visibility informs you of a delayed shipment. Predictive intelligence informs you of a probable delay before it occurs.

Organizations must shift from descriptive analytics (“what is happening”) to predictive and prescriptive analytics (“what will happen” and “what should we do”). This is where the importance of advanced supply chain analytics services comes into play. With the use of machine learning models, scenario planning tools, and demand forecasting solutions, organizations can predict disruptions, optimize inventory, and redesign sourcing approaches before they become threats.

For example, if an organization realizes that inventory levels are dropping, visibility points to the problem. But predictive analytics can forecast when stockouts will happen and suggest replenishment plans according to demand. In 2026, the pace of decision-making is fueled by foresight, not just awareness.

Agility Over Transparency

Another limitation of visibility alone is the lack of operational agility. Even if companies can see disruptions clearly, their systems and contracts with suppliers may not allow them to react accordingly.

Agility requires diverse supplier bases, dynamic inventory models, flexible transportation models, and decision-making structures. Companies should be able to divert their shipments, shift their production locations globally, or switch suppliers without significant delay.

Moreover, the integration of competitive market intelligence services enables organizations to make their supply chain strategies consistent with market trends, competitor strategies, and pricing dynamics. Awareness of market movements ensures that supply chain strategies are not only reactive to disruptions but also strategically aligned with broader competitive positioning.

In today’s hyper-connected world, supply chains need to be designed for rapid reconfiguration. Without agility, visibility simply means watching a problem unfold in real time without the ability to do anything about it.

The Growing Importance of Resilience

Resilience has become a strategic focus in 2026. Supply chains are no longer optimized for cost efficiency. Organizations are now balancing efficiency with risk mitigation.

Resilient supply chains have redundancy, multi-sourcing, nearshoring, and contingency planning. Visibility can help analyze risks, but resilience can help maintain continuity during a disruption.

For example, an organization can have complete visibility into its single-source supplier. However, if the supplier is experiencing geopolitical or financial instability, visibility alone will not help the organization. Resilience is about being proactive in diversifying the supply sources and testing the network against potential risks.

Data Integration Is Still a Challenge

Despite technological advancements, many organizations still face issues with fragmented systems. Data may be visible within silos, but it may not be integrated across procurement, manufacturing, logistics, and sales.

The true value of data can be achieved when it is integrated seamlessly across the entire enterprise ecosystem. Data integration helps make decisions holistically rather than reactively. Without a unified data architecture, data visibility may result in information overload rather than clarity.

Furthermore, data quality remains a concern. Inaccurate or delayed data may result in poor decision-making, even when systems appear transparent. In 2026, data governance and analytics capabilities will be as critical as data visibility tools.

Sustainability and Compliance Pressures

The modern supply chain also needs to meet sustainability and compliance challenges. Governments and consumers are increasingly demanding transparency about carbon footprint, ethical sourcing, and labor practices.

Data visibility can monitor environmental data and supplier compliance. However, organizations need to do more by integrating sustainability into procurement, transportation, and product design. This requires alignment and action plans, not just monitoring.

Organizations that focus solely on visibility may fail to meet environmental and governance expectations. They need to integrate ESG objectives into the overall supply chain strategy to be competitive and compliant.

Human Decision-Making Still Matters

Even in highly automated environments, human intelligence is essential. Visibility tools offer data, but it is up to leadership to make strategic decisions. Supply chain leaders must analyze insights, balance trade-offs, and align operational decisions with business strategy.

In 2026, the most successful organizations leverage technology and the expertise of professionals who are knowledgeable in risk management, scenario planning, and cross-functional collaboration. Visibility enhances decision-making, but it does not replace the need for strategic thinking.

The Future: Intelligent, Autonomous Supply Chains

The future of supply chain management is intelligent and semi-autonomous systems. Intelligent supply chains leverage visibility, predictive analytics, automation, digital twins, and AI-driven recommendations.

Digital twins enable organizations to simulate disruptions before they happen. AI-driven planning tools adjust procurement and logistics strategies dynamically. Automated processes initiate corrective actions automatically.

In this environment, visibility becomes just one layer within a broader ecosystem of intelligence and action. Organizations that merely focus on visibility will fall behind those that embrace end-to-end digital transformation.

Conclusion

Supply chain visibility was once a breakthrough innovation. In 2026, it is a foundational requirement. Transparency alone cannot mitigate disruptions, build resilience, or enable strategic agility. Organizations need to move from visibility to predictive intelligence, flexibility, data integration, resilience planning, and sustainability alignment. The successful companies in 2026 will not only be able to see their supply chains but will also be able to understand them, predict, and respond accordingly.
